- How do Sri Lanka and Georgia compare on GDP?
- Sri Lanka has a GDP of $99.0 billion, while Georgia has $33.8 billion. Sri Lanka leads on this indicator.
- How do Sri Lanka and Georgia compare on GDP per Capita?
- Sri Lanka has a GDP per Capita of $4,515.568, while Georgia has $9,193.664. Georgia leads on this indicator.
